백신 소프트웨어 개발 분야는 빠르게 변화하는 IT 환경에서 매우 중요한 역할을 하고 있어요. 다수의 사용자와 기업이 사이버 공격으로부터 보호받기를 원하기 때문에 백신 소프트웨어에 대한 수요는 끊이지 않죠. 이번 포스트에서는 백신 소프트웨어 개발자로서 취업한 후 동료들과의 경험, 직무에 대한 조언, 그리고 현실적인 취업 후기를 공유하고자 해요.
✅ 광고 차단과 시스템 보호의 팁을 지금 바로 알아보세요.
백신 소프트웨어 개발의 중요성
백신 소프트웨어는 사이버 보안의 첫 방어선이에요. 매일같이 수천 개의 악성 코드와 바이러스가 생성되고 있으니, 이를 차단하기 위한 기술적 접근이 필수적이죠.
사이버 공격의 현황
- 2023년 사이버 공격의 증가율은 40%에 달하고 있다는 통계가 있어요.
- 기업의 60%가 연간 한 번 이상 보안 침해를 경험한다는 연구 결과가 있죠.
이러한 데이터들은 백신 소프트웨어의 개발과 업데이트가 얼마나 중요한지를 잘 보여줘요.
✅ 육아휴직 후 직장 복귀 시 필요한 팁과 전략을 알아보세요.
취업 후 사람들의 경험
많은 개발자들이 백신 소프트웨어 분야에 들어오기를 원하지만, 실제 경험에 대해 들어보는 것은 드물어요. 여러 후기를 모아보니 크게 두 가지 카테고리로 나뉘는 것 같아요.
긍정적인 경험
- 창의적인 문제 해결: 반복적으로 기존 알고리즘을 개선하고 새로운 방식을 발견하는 것이 재미있다는 의견이 많았어요.
- 직업 안정성: 사이버 보안 분야는 지속적으로 성장하고 있으며, 특히 백신 소프트웨어 개발자는 높은 연봉과 안정적인 직업을 누릴 확률이 높아요.
부정적인 경험
- 고된 업무 환경: 때로는 과도한 업무와 마감일 스트레스로 인해 힘든 경우도 많았어요.
- 기술적 한계: 기존의 많은 백신 소프트웨어가 강력하기 때문에 새로운 기술을 개발하는 데 어려움이 있다는 피드백도 있었죠.
✅ 백신 소프트웨어 개발 분야의 취업 전략을 자세히 알아보세요.
직무에 대한 조언
백신 소프트웨어 개발자로서 성공적으로 커리어를 쌓기 위해서는 몇 가지 중요한 요소가 있어요.
필수 기술
- 프로그래밍 언어: C++, Java, Python 등 다양한 언어에 대한 숙련도가 필요해요.
- 네트워크 이해: 데이터 전송 방식과 네트워크 구조에 대해 깊게 이해해야 해요, 이건 백신 프로그램이 공격으로부터 어떻게 보호하는지를 설명하는 데 필수적이니까요.
지속적인 학습
사이버 보안은 종류가 다양하고 계속해서 변화하는 분야예요. 기술을 배우고 개선하는 것을 게을리 하지 않아야 해요. 예를 들어, 매년 최신 보안 트렌드와 공격 기법에 대한 연구를 계속하여 지식을 업데이트해야 해요.
팀과의 협업 중요성
- 팀원들과의 원활한 소통은 프로젝트의 성공에 매우 중요한 요소예요.
- 여러 개발자와 보안 전문가, 테스터들이 모여 아이디어를 공유하며 고품질의 결과물을 만들어내는게 중요하죠.
✅ 데이터 분석가의 필수 스킬을 지금 바로 알아보세요.
백신 소프트웨어 개발자의 커리어 로드맵
커리어를 잘 쌓기 위해서는 프로그래머로 시작해 상위 역할로 발전하는 것이 효과적이에요.
단계 | 설명 |
---|---|
1단계 | 프로그래머: 기본 프로그래밍 기술 및 네트워크 기초 확보 |
2단계 | 주니어 개발자: 팀 프로젝트 참여 및 경험 습득 |
3단계 | 중급 개발자: 독립적인 프로젝트 관리 및 기술적 조언 제공 |
4단계 | 시니어 개발자: 전략 및 비전 수립, 팀 리더 역할 |
결론
백신 소프트웨어 개발은 도전적이지만 보람차고, 잘만 하면 안정된 직업을 가질 수 있는 기회를 제공해요. 나의 경험과 동료들의 이야기를 통해 얻은 통찰력을 바탕으로 여러분도 이 분야에 도전해보면 좋겠어요. 사이버 보안의 중요성이 날로 커지는 이 시대에, 여러분의 기술로 세상을 더 안전하게 만들 수 있는 기회를 잡아보세요!
이 글이 여러분에게 도움이 되었길 바라며, 더 나아가고 싶은 목표를 향해 나아가길 응원할게요!
자주 묻는 질문 Q&A
Q1: 백신 소프트웨어 개발이 왜 중요한가요?
A1: 백신 소프트웨어는 사이버 보안의 첫 방어선으로, 매일같이 수천 개의 악성 코드가 생성되어 이를 차단하는 기술적 접근이 필수적입니다.
Q2: 백신 소프트웨어 개발자로서의 긍정적인 경험은 어떤 것들이 있나요?
A2: 긍정적인 경험으로는 창의적인 문제 해결의 재미와 직업 안정성이 있으며, 사이버 보안 분야의 지속적인 성장으로 높은 연봉과 안정적인 직업을 누릴 수 있습니다.
Q3: 백신 소프트웨어 개발자가 갖추어야 할 필수 기술은 무엇인가요?
A3: 필수 기술로는 C++, Java, Python 등 다양한 프로그래밍 언어에 대한 숙련도와 데이터 전송 방식 및 네트워크 구조에 대한 깊은 이해가 필요합니다.